The client is a large membership body that has been operating in the UK since the early 1900s and brings together both the customer and company sides of the organisation.

Job Description

The responsibilities of the Payroll Administrator & AP Assistant Accountant include but are not limited to:

  • Processing monthly payroll
  • Ensuring pension records are updated
  • Assist with the input of supplier invoices
  • Monthly reconciliation and reporting of the corporate credit card accounts
  • Assist with the year-end statutory accounts production process
  • Provide support for ad hoc projects as required

The Successful Applicant

The successful Payroll Administrator & AP Assistant Accountant must be AAT level 4 or part qualified to ACCA/CIMA. The applicant must also have strong experience processing payroll and have covered some aspects of a finance role too.

The applicant must also have strong communication skills, be confident, be able to demonstrate initiative as well as being punctual, polite and professional.

What's on Offer

On offer for the successful applicant is a salary of up to £28,000 depending on experience and a competitive benefits package including 75% off of rail fares.
